Product Description

The Jordan 1 Retro Low OG Mocha is a low-top shoe whose design was inspired by the 80s basketball look.
  
The Mocha Jordan 1 Retro Low OG has an upper made of white leather. This material and color form the side panels and the toebox, which also has perforations for extra air flow. A black leather overlay serves as the toecap and mudguard and attaches the bottom eyelets to the midsole. Thin black Nike Swooshes also appear in black leather on each side. Suede in Dark Mocha forms the heel counter and heel collar, and the heel collar also features a black Air Jordan logo. The tongue also bears a Dark Mocha Nike Air patch. A white midsole and black outsole complete the look. 

The most interesting feature of this shoe are the way the black and Dark Mocha colors work together, adding a hint of subtle elegance. The Jordan 1 Retro Low OG Mocha was released on September 21, 2024, for $140.
